Webb23 jan. 2024 · However, there is a HIPAA rule that permits disclosure of PHI without prior obtained consent for healthcare operations, treatment, and payment. This includes consultation between providers regarding a patient, referring a patient, and information required by law for public health safety and reporting.

Laws authorizing minors to consent and laws protecting confidentiality are closely linked but they do not always WebbHIPAA established a “floor” for the protection of PHI. This means that when state laws are more protective of PHI than HIPAA, the state law controls instead of the federal HIPAA law. Several Tennessee privacy laws are more protective of citizen’s health information than federal law.

Although HIPAA does not give special protection to mental health records as compared to psychotherapy notes, state laws may. To the extent those state laws are more restrictive than HIPAA, providers are required to comply with those laws in addition to HIPAA. (45 C.F.R. § 160.203).

WebbThe use of recordings in supervision is widely known. Trainees regularly audio or videotape sessions with clients for their clinical supervisors to review, both prior to meeting for supervision and jointly in supervision sessions.
